Where do I park on campus for a tour?

  • Visitor parking is available for guests who come on a registered campus tour and can be found on the Office of Admissions & Recruitment’s website. After registering online for a campus tour, visitors will receive a link to their personalized parking pass within their confirmation email.
  • If you forget your parking permit, we will be able to provide one for you when you check in for your tour at the Oklahoma Memorial Union - Beaird Lounge, located on the 2nd floor.

What about general visitor parking on campus?

  • OU Parking Services offers parking passes for visitors, as certain spaces and areas in campus parking facilities are designated for use by visitors. OU Parking Maps are available online. One-day visitor permits are $3 and can be purchased online. Pay stations and metered spaces are also available.

Jones Family Welcome Center

The University of Oklahoma received a $15 million gift from longtime supporters Jonny and Brenda Jones to help fund the renovation and expansion of Jacobson Hall. Building construction began in Summer 2023, and campus tours will continue through the renovation.
